// Copyright (C) 2022 The Qt Company Ltd.
// SPDX-License-Identifier: LicenseRef-Qt-Commercial OR GPL-3.0-only WITH Qt-GPL-exception-1.0
#include "fsengine.h"
#ifdef QTC_UTILS_WITH_FSENGINE
#include "fsenginehandler.h"
#else
class Utils::Internal::FSEngineHandler
{};
#endif
#include <memory>
namespace Utils {
FSEngine::FSEngine()
: m_engineHandler(std::make_unique<Internal::FSEngineHandler>())
{}
FSEngine::~FSEngine() {}
bool FSEngine::isAvailable()
{
#ifdef QTC_UTILS_WITH_FSENGINE
return true;
#else
return false;
#endif
}
FilePaths FSEngine::registeredDeviceRoots()
{
return FSEngine::deviceRoots();
}
void FSEngine::addDevice(const FilePath &deviceRoot)
{
deviceRoots().append(deviceRoot);
}
void FSEngine::removeDevice(const FilePath &deviceRoot)
{
deviceRoots().removeAll(deviceRoot);
}
FilePaths &FSEngine::deviceRoots()
{
static FilePaths g_deviceRoots;
return g_deviceRoots;
}
QStringList &FSEngine::deviceSchemes()
{
static QStringList g_deviceSchemes{"device"};
return g_deviceSchemes;
}
void FSEngine::registerDeviceScheme(const QStringView scheme)
{
deviceSchemes().append(scheme.toString());
}
void FSEngine::unregisterDeviceScheme(const QStringView scheme)
{
deviceSchemes().removeAll(scheme.toString());
}
QStringList FSEngine::registeredDeviceSchemes()
{
return FSEngine::deviceSchemes();
}
} // namespace Utils
